ON Semiconductor Corp. (NASDAQ:ON) has demonstrated strong financial performance in its third-quarter 2024 earnings report. The company reported earnings per share (EPS) of $0.99, surpassing the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$0.97. Despite this positive surprise, the EPS is lower than the previous year's $1.39, indicating a year-over-year decline.
The company also reported revenue of approximately $1.76 billion, exceeding the estimated $1.75 billion. This revenue growth highlights robust demand across ON's business segments and end-market products, as highlighted by Zacks Investment Research. Such performance may positively influence the company's share price, especially with an optimistic outlook for future performance.
ON's financial metrics provide further insights into its market valuation. The price-to-earnings (P/E) ratio is approximately 16.01, reflecting how the market values the company's earnings. The price-to-sales ratio is about 3.97, indicating the market value relative to sales. These ratios suggest that investors have a moderate valuation of ON's earnings and sales.
The company's enterprise value to sales ratio stands at around 4.15, and the enterprise value to operating cash flow ratio is approximately 15.87. These figures offer a perspective on how ON's total value compares to its sales and cash flow from operations. The earnings yield of about 6.25% provides insight into the return on investment for shareholders.
ON's financial health is further supported by a debt-to-equity ratio of approximately 0.40, indicating a moderate level of debt relative to equity. The current ratio of around 3.01 suggests strong liquidity, demonstrating the company's ability to cover its short-term liabilities effectively.
